Benevolent and Protective Order of Elks Lodge
Benevolent and Protective Order of Elks Lodge is a historic place in Montrose, Montrose County, Colorado, listed on the United States National Register of Historic Places on April 6, 2004. Its National Register reference number is 04000260.
